Unlocking Insights from How Fitness Trackers Enhance Your Knowledge of Sleep and Heart Rate
Fitness trackers have become ubiquitous tools for monitoring our physical activity. But, their capabilities extend far beyond simply tracking steps. These gadgets can offer valuable insights into two crucial aspects of our well-being: sleep and heart rate. By diligently recording and analyzing these metrics, fitness trackers empower us to develop a more thorough understanding of our overall health.
One key benefit of using a fitness tracker is its ability to provide detailed information about your nocturnal activity. These devices can monitor factors such as time spent sleeping, sleep stages (light, deep, REM), and even wakefulness. , Users can identify trends their sleep habits. For example, a tracker might reveal that you consistently struggle with falling asleep at night. This awareness can then be used to make adjustments to improve sleep hygiene and promote more restful nights.
Beyond sleep, fitness trackers also play a vital role in monitoring your heart rate. Offer real-time heart rate data throughout the day, as well as during workouts. This information can be highly valuable in understanding your cardiovascular health and fitness levels. A noticeable elevation in heart rate during exercise is normal, but a consistently elevated resting heart rate could indicate underlying health issues. By tracking heart rate trends over time, you can become more aware your body's response to stress, activity, and overall well-being.
Such data can guide your choices regarding your lifestyle and fitness routine to optimize your health.
Ultimately, fitness trackers go past simply counting steps. They serve as powerful tools for personal assessment by providing valuable insights into our sleep patterns, heart rate, and overall well-being. By embracing these insights, we can make informed decisions about our health and take proactive steps to improve our lives.
